现在,Dify 在应用编排中新增了 Agent Assistant 模式(智能助手),可以基于不同的 LLMs 作为基础的自然语言理解和推理模型(目前 Dify 已支持市面上所有流行的 LLMs ),并提供一系列工具让 LLM 根据需要来调用,解决多步骤的复杂问题场景,帮助开发者构建更具想象力的 GPTs 和 Agent Assistants(智能助手)。
这里我将一步一步地带领你用 Dify 最新的 Agent 能力来搭建一个美股投资分析的 AI 小助手。里面会回答你的一系列问题:
-
Dify 怎么用?
-
如何编写好用的提示词?
-
怎么在 Dify 上发布应用,并整合到自己的工作流中?
这个智能助手可以借助 Yahoo 财经的三个工具 — News、Analytics 和 Ticker 来生成一份任一上市公司的投资分析报告。
先给我们的 AI Agent 来一个才艺展示。
先告诉 Agent 你对哪家上市公司感兴趣,随后它就可以帮你搜集和整理任何美股上市公司的财务状况、行业地位和最新消息,几秒钟内就能构建一个 Markdown 格式的投资报告。而且这还没完,这个 Agent 不会生成完报告之后就消失,你随时可以和他继续聊任何你想了解的领域。
这个 Agent 有什么用?什么地方能用到它?
Agent Assistant 是一种泛用的 AI 工具,任何需要重复劳动的场景都可以用 Agent 来自动化,比如投研和写投资报告。如果交给一个人来做,他会需要去各个不同的数据源找几十上百家公司的数据来进行整理和分析。像 Agent Assistant 这样的智能助手就帮我解决了这些问题:
-
自动化调研的流程,只要告诉它你需要分析什么公司,它就能自动生成出一份报告
-
提升了效率,减少查阅资料浪费的时间
-
不需要费太多精力就可以快速了解一家公司
-
不需要到处找信息,切换不同的信息源
这虽然是一个简单的机器人,一旦构建出来就可以省很多重复工作。
一步一步的带你制作投资分析助手:从配置 Tools 到高级提示词工程
如何搭建 Agent Assistant?
创建应用
写提示词
配置智能助手需要使用的 Tools (工具)
What's next? 如何投入生产?
前提条件
-
注册或者部署 Dify.AI
Dify 是一个开源产品,你可以在 GitHub (https://github.com/langgenius/dify)上找到它并部署在你本地或公司内网。同时它提供了云端 SaaS 版本,访问 https://dify.ai/zh 注册即可使用。
-
申请 OpenAI 等模型厂商的 API key<